快乐的梦鱼 1 month ago
parent
commit
dff9159b44
4 changed files with 6 additions and 6 deletions
  1. 1 1
      src/pages/channel/[id].vue
  2. 1 1
      src/pages/channel/laws.vue
  3. 3 3
      src/pages/index.vue
  4. 1 1
      src/pages/search.vue

+ 1 - 1
src/pages/channel/[id].vue

@@ -74,7 +74,7 @@
                 <div class="news-list">
                   <div v-for="(item, key) in articlesData.content.value?.items" :key="key" class="news-item">
                     <router-link :to="'/page/' + item.id" class="title">{{ item.title }}</router-link>
-                    <span class="date">{{ DateUtils.formatDate(new Date(item.publishtime * 1000), 'yyyy-MM-dd') }}</span>
+                    <span class="date">{{ DateUtils.formatDate(new Date((item.createtime ||item.publishtime) * 1000), 'yyyy-MM-dd') }}</span>
                   </div>
                   <div v-if="!articlesData.content.value || articlesData.content.value.empty" class="no-news">暂无相关文章</div>
                 </div>

+ 1 - 1
src/pages/channel/laws.vue

@@ -64,7 +64,7 @@
                       {{ item.title }}
                     </router-link>
                     <span class="date">
-                      {{ DateUtils.formatDate(new Date(item.publishtime * 1000), 'yyyy-MM-dd') }}
+                      {{ DateUtils.formatDate(new Date((item.createtime || item.publishtime) * 1000), 'yyyy-MM-dd') }}
                     </span>
                   </div>
                   <div v-if="articlesData.content.value?.empty" class="no-news text-center">

+ 3 - 3
src/pages/index.vue

@@ -48,7 +48,7 @@
                     <router-link :to="'/page/' + notice.id" class="notice-title">{{ notice.title }}</router-link>
                     <p>{{ notice.description }}</p>
                   </div>
-                  <span class="notice-publishtime">{{ DataDateUtils.formatDate(new Date(notice.publishtime * 1000), 'yyyy-MM-dd') }}</span>
+                  <span class="notice-publishtime">{{ DataDateUtils.formatDate(new Date((notice.createtime || notice.publishtime) * 1000), 'yyyy-MM-dd') }}</span>
                 </div>
               </SimplePageContentLoader>
             </div>
@@ -56,7 +56,7 @@
               <SimplePageContentLoader :loader="hot" :showEmpty="!hot.content.value?.items?.length">
                 <div v-for="item in hot.content.value?.items" :key="item.id" class="news-item">
                   <router-link :to="'/page/' + item.id" class="title">{{ item.title }}</router-link>
-                  <span class="publishtime">{{ DataDateUtils.formatDate(new Date(item.publishtime * 1000), 'yyyy-MM-dd') }}</span>
+                  <span class="publishtime">{{ DataDateUtils.formatDate(new Date((item.createtime ||item.publishtime) * 1000), 'yyyy-MM-dd') }}</span>
                 </div>
               </SimplePageContentLoader>
             </div>
@@ -112,7 +112,7 @@
                 <SimplePageContentLoader :loader="partyBuilding" :showEmpty="!partyBuilding.content.value?.items?.length">
                   <div v-for="item in partyBuilding.content.value?.items" :key="item.id" class="news-item">
                     <router-link :to="'/page/' + item.id" class="title">{{ item.title }}</router-link>
-                    <span class="publishtime">{{ DataDateUtils.formatDate(new Date(item.publishtime * 1000), 'yyyy-MM-dd') }}</span>
+                    <span class="publishtime">{{ DataDateUtils.formatDate(new Date((item.createtime || item.publishtime) * 1000), 'yyyy-MM-dd') }}</span>
                   </div>
                 </SimplePageContentLoader>
               </div>

+ 1 - 1
src/pages/search.vue

@@ -32,7 +32,7 @@
                 <div class="news-list">
                   <div v-for="(item, key) in articlesData.content.value?.items" :key="key" class="news-item">
                     <router-link :to="'/page/' + item.id" class="title">{{ item.title }}</router-link>
-                    <span class="date">{{ DateUtils.formatDate(new Date(item.publishtime * 1000), 'yyyy-MM-dd') }}</span>
+                    <span class="date">{{ DateUtils.formatDate(new Date((item.createtime || item.publishtime) * 1000), 'yyyy-MM-dd') }}</span>
                   </div>
                   <div v-if="!articlesData.content.value || articlesData.content.value.empty" class="no-news">暂无相关文章</div>
                 </div>